Transaction 21fae5a540e30b7c3feb3b1e758d1de79f886af3782b044fb93c27f551bc7d42
1 Input
1 Output
-
21fae5a540e30b7c3feb3b1e758d1de79f886af3782b044fb93c27f551bc7d42:0
- value
- 19236600
- script pubkey
- OP_0 OP_PUSHBYTES_20 afe582a56501162898958e5d6257746767b35686
- address
- bc1q4ljc9ft9qytz3xy43ewky4m5vanmx45xcj0f37